Transaction 59f8cbe63bfd9628b611cb5305e11da816a1d1c76d56065672d03b77640c3f31
1 Input
1 Output
-
59f8cbe63bfd9628b611cb5305e11da816a1d1c76d56065672d03b77640c3f31:0
- value
- 117796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46f9290c6c18be9eaa78feed8d5c035f661a68ed OP_EQUAL
- address
- 38AHhwFf9ZvQLGrqkjgNTki1HXqDH39Sv9